India to deliver 600 million vaccines in the next 6 to 8 months

The government will deploy its expansive machinery to provide 600 million COVID-19 vaccines in the coming six to eight months to the most vulnerable individuals. The government is also prepared for cold storages with temperatures ranging from 2 to 8°C, said V.K Paul. At present, Indian regulators are considering three vaccines for emergency use authorization, including those from Pfizer Inc, AstraZeneca and Bharat Biotech.
